匿名使用者
匿名使用者 發問時間: 電腦與網際網路軟體 · 2 0 年前

關聯式代數join?

natural join 可以含NULL值嗎?為什麼?

什麼是full-outer-join?

1 個解答

評分
  • 匿名使用者
    2 0 年前
    最佳解答

    join是可以包含NULL值的

    外部合併是使用關聯表主鍵和其關聯性(Relationship)關聯表的外來鍵為條件執行合併,只不過這是一種完全的值組合併,運算元的關聯表需要供獻全部值組。

    外部合併依供獻的運算元不同可以分為三種:

    左外部合併(Left Outer Join)

    右外部合併(Right Outer Join)

    完全外部合併(Full Outer Join)

    完全外部合併執行結果的關聯表是取回兩邊關聯表的所有值組

    例如:Students和Instructors關聯表的完全外部合併運算式,如下所示:

    Result = Students[left]><[right]Instructors

    參考資料: 資料庫課本
還有問題?馬上發問,尋求解答。